- The distance between Dalwhinnie, Scotland, Uk and Dagoretti, Kenya is approximately 7,437 km or 4,621 mi.
- To reach Dalwhinnie, Scotland in this distance one would set out from Dagoretti bearing 337.1°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Dalwhinnie, Scotland bearing 314.5° or NW .
- Both have a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Dalwhinnie, Scotland is in or near the boreal rain forest biome whereas Dagoretti is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 11.6 °C (20.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.2 °C (14.8°F) more in Dalwhinnie, Scotland.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 155.5 mm (6.1 in) more which is equivalent to 155.5 l/m² (3.82 US gal/ft²) or 1,555,000 l/ha (166,240 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 41.5° lower in Dalwhinnie, Scotland than in Dagoretti.
